Giraffes are adored for their towering height and unique spotted coats, but their story extends far beyond their distinctive appearance. This high-school nonfiction title explores the life cycle, diet, anatomy, and habitat of these gentle giants. Additionally, readers will learn about conservation efforts and the giraffe's cultural significance in human history. Captivating photos and intriguing facts are accompanied by sidebars, a glossary, selected bibliography, websites, and an index.
